J. Kenneth Orms 61, of Scottsdale, AZ died tragically on March 20, 2006 while flying back to his home in Scottsdale. Ken was an intrepid entrepreneur his whole life and was the owner of Platinum Real Estate & Mortgages of Tucson and Scottsdale. Ken was preceded in death by his father, Stuart...
